There’s nothing like waiting for your online order to arrive. The anticipation of the perfect answer to your needs (or wants), all neatly wrapped up. The doorbell rings, your heart flutters... finally! A thirst is quenched. In that moment, a brown, ordinary box holds so much value. We unwrap it with excitement and expectation, and just like that, the cardboard outer shell becomes somewhat futile.
It’s funny how we find ourselves valuing our worth by all the things we put into a box. Strongly upholding our careers, our relationships, the awards we achieve and the hats we wear. For most, these are unpacked and re-packed on a daily basis. We know which item to showcase when we need it.
I posed the question: What if we took a step outside of the box? How do we know our value without the adjectives that define us?
Having wrestled with self-worth, pretty much from infancy, my cardboard casing felt quite unstable and not very structurally sound. I battled my way through university, thinking that studying something noble would be a great item to add to my small collection of achievements, a hat I could wear to help me feel more valuable. Without knowing it, the very thing that I thought would make me feel valuable brought destruction. In a moment of desperation, I took a big step out of my box - I started my journey in WHATUSEE. It’s been uncomfortable, challenging, a little confusing, but mostly a huge lesson of grace.
So, I pose a suggestion: Take a step outside of your box - be consumed with something that is not on your priority list. Take a second to learn and gain perspective from a different view. Be humbled. This is not to say that your achievements are worthless, but once all is stripped away, when we are exposed and vulnerable, our value doesn’t lie inside the place we keep putting it.
I know that in failures I am worthy, I am valuable even without my achievements. Mostly, my value is in Jesus, the most Worthy of all died on a cross because He finds me so valuable.
Stepping outside of the box reminds us that our true value isn’t measured by what we accumulate or the labels we wear. It’s found in the moments of vulnerability, growth, and perspective.
